Section 233B(5)

IA 1986
Insolvency Act 1986 · United Kingdom

Where a provision of a contract ceases to have effect under subsection (3) or an entitlement under a provision of a contract is not exercisable under subsection (4), the supplier may terminate the contract if— in a case where the company has become subject to a relevant insolvency procedure as specified in subsection (2)(b), (c), (e) or (f), the office-holder consents to the termination of the contract, in any other case, the company consents to the termination of the contract, or the court is satisfied that the continuation of the contract would cause the supplier hardship and grants permission for the termination of the contract.
